WHAT IS MICROBLADING?
This is the process of implanting pigment into the skin to create the appearance of natural hair. It is considered permanent makeup. Although it is considered permanent makeup, it does fade over time. Touch-ups are suggested once every 12-24 months in order to keep the color fresh and shape precisely. Please go into this with the expectation that it is meant to

fade. The longer out you have your touch-ups the better your skin is and the better your outcome will be for years to come.

Microblading is meant to be a natural enhancement, and to create the appearance of full, beautiful brows. It looks most natural on clients who already have semi-full brow hair, and are wanting to perfect their shape. The more hair you have, the more natural it will appear.

Microblading heals best on young, healthy skin that is normal-dry.

Oily skin and aging/thin skin are not recommended for microblading. Results will not heal as well, or look as natural. If you have aging or oily skin, you are better suited for a Microshading or Shading!

 

 WHAT IS SHADING/POWDER BROW?

Powder brows, unlike microblading is a more saturated brow. This is done with an electrical machine and peppered into your skin. The look is more filled in (like make-up) with less trauma to the skin than microblading. Shading brows have no hairstrokes present.

Shaded brows can be done in combination with microblading to add density and blend hairs and hair strokes placed.

IS IT PAINFUL?

Pain tolerance levels vary depending on which area we are working on and can differ from person to person. For all services, a highly-effective topical anesthetic cream is used for numbing during your procedure.

**Please read ALL pre-procedure information to see what you can avoid in order to make your experience more comfortable with optimal results!

**Please note, having services performed during your menstrual cycle may increase discomfort during your procedure. If you are a frequent smoker, the topical aesthetics used during the treatment will not last as long. Certain medical conditions or medications may affect your sensitivity tolerance to the procedure.

HOW LONG WILL MY PERMANENT COSMETICS LAST?

Cosmetic tattooing is designed to fade over time. Factors such as skin type, lifestyle, age, metabolism, medications, and pigment color affect the longevity of the tattoo. The sun and some kinds of lighting (tanning beds) can affect the rate at which these pigments are broken down. To take care of your brows follow the aftercare instructions and touch-up your brows every 18-24 months (or as needed). Touch-ups are normal and expected for Permanent Cosmetics.

*Please note that final results vary and CAN NOT be guaranteed due to the nature of skin as it heals. A follow-up appointment is recommended at 4-6 weeks where we can assess your pigment retention and make any necessary changes.

 

 WHAT FACTORS COULD AFFECT MY PERMANENT COSMETICS?

Oily Skin: the more oil in your skin the less crisp heal strokes will look. I might recommend powder effect for these clients.

Smoking: Smokers may notice that their permanent cosmetics fade faster Anemia and iron deficiency: Your body will absorb iron based pigments more quickly which will result in the fading of pigment.

Sun exposure: Sun damaged skin will cause premature fading. Any sunburn or tan skin will need to reschedule when skin is back to normal. Any sun exposure after getting permanent cosmetics will need to apply sunblock and or wear a large hat to cover.

Age and metabolism: The faster your metabolism is, the faster your pigment will fade.

Excessive Bleeding: Excessive bleeding during your appointment will greatly affect how your body absorbs pigment. While this is not entirely in our control, please follow pre- procedure guidelines to help minimize as much as we can. This includes avoiding blood thinning medications, alcohol, and caffeine 24 hours prior to your appointment.

HOW SHOULD I PREPARE FOR MY APPOINTMENT?

No Botox, fillers, chemical peels, microdermabrasion, facials of any sort for 30 days before and after your appointment.

If you regularly get your treatment area shaped, waxed, threaded, or tinted, please do so at least 10 days before your appointment. We will shape the treatment area to give you a natural look. Any stray hairs or hairs outside of shape will be taken off during appointment.

Plan your vacations accordingly, it is recommended to plan your trip for a minimum of 14 days.

BEFORE and AFTER the procedure.

  • Avoid any blood thinners 5 days prior to the appointment and 24 hours after.

  • Avoid caffeine for 12 hours prior to the appointment.

  • Avoid alcohol for 24 hours prior to the appointment.

  • If you have been on a prescription for Accutane in the past, you MUST wait at least one year before considering this procedure.

  • Chemotherapy/Radiation must be done a minimum of 8 months before getting permanent cosmetics done.

    

 It is required that you avoid SUN and artificial tanning exposure for 14 days prior to and after your procedure. If you come to your appointment with a tan or a sunburn, you will need to reschedule and will forfeit your deposit. As your skin exfoliates from sun damage, it will take the pigment with it.

WILL COSMETIC TATTOOING WORK FOR ME?

If you have extremely oily skin, the hair stroke eyebrow technique will NOT work well for you, regardless of the tools used. The constant production of oil will cause the hair strokes to heal with a diffused, softer look. Your end result will look more powdered than you would expect.

If you have little to no existing hair, your tattoo will appear more 2-dimensional than those clients who have more hair naturally.

If you are a frequent smoker, your pigment may fade sooner.

If you are iron deficient or Anemic, your pigment may fade sooner, and bleeding/ bruising may occur during and after the procedure.

PLEASE NOTE: If you have had your treatment area previously tattooed, we cannot predict what the results will be. We won't know what types of pigments or tools were used. In some cases where the previous work is too dark, dense, discolored, or large, tattoo removal may be recommended before we can offer our services. Previously tattooed areas will almost

always require additional sessions and will be charged accordingly.

 DOING ANY OF THE FOLLOWING WILL COMPROMISE THE RESULTS AND MAY RESULT IN EXCESSIVE BLEEDING:

Do not work out the day of the appointment

No working out the first 3-5 days after your appointment. After those days you can resume your workouts but try to perform low impact workouts that do not include heavy sweating.

Until you reach days 10-14. Any type of excessive sweating will fade out your brows.

Once you are past the 2-week mark you may resume high impact and sweating.

Cleanse your brows morning and evening with soap to keep them clean and bacteria free.

Apply a small amount of balm to both brows 2x a day for 5-10 days. You do not need a lot of balm on them. Apply a pea-size amount.

You may wear make-up around your brows but not on your eyebrows for 10-14 days. be cautious when removing foundation, bronzer, eyeshadow, eyeliner, mascara, etc.

Avoid direct sun exposure for 10-14 days. If extended sun exposure is happening you must cover your brows completely with an oversized hat and apply MINERAL sunscreen on them every hour. Direct sun exposure will fade your brows out.

Do not pick at, rub, scratch, or touch the brows. Do not pick the scabs or flakes as they come off, this will remove the pigment in that area and will result in patchiness.

No anti-aging or acne products on your brows ever. Get in the habit of avoiding them when putting on your skincare products.

Retinol use may affect your results long term and can give your brows a more ashy tone. Be aware of this and avoid your forehead when using it.

 

DO I REALLY NEED A TOUCH-UP APPOINTMENT?

Yes! All permanent cosmetics require 2 sessions. The touch-up appointment allows us to adjust, darken, and asses your pigment retention. The touch-up will increase the longevity of your permanent cosmetics.

WILL PERMANENT COSMETICS REPLACE MY MAKE-UP?

The answer is NO! Please do not get this done with the expectation of never having to wear make-up again. Permanent cosmetics to move your baseline up from what you have into a fuller more defined eyebrow, eyeliner or lip.

My goal is to have you not reach out for make-up as often as you normally would but depending on natural hair growth and make-up preference you might still need to fill in your brows. That being said the shape is much more defined and easier to fill in.

Permanent cosmetics heal into the skin which can result in an ashier appearance. Make-up goes on top of the skin which has a much more vibrant, bolder, and warmer color.

HOW DO YOU KNOW WHAT COLOR TO USE?

When we choose the color we match it to your eyebrow hair color, not the hair on your head. We want the cosmetic tattoo to blend with your eyebrow hairs to create the most natural outcome. If you do not have hair, don't worry we always go with what will look best on you.

Keep in mind that going too dark will overpower your face and look bold and going too light will look faded. We mix and custom colors to create a color suitable for you. Every client has undertones and overtones that we take into consideration as well.
